A damaged backsplash โ a cracked tile, a section that's come loose, blown-out grout behind the sink โ is small in scope but glaring in a kitchen, and left alone it lets water reach the wall behind it. Water is the usual culprit โ a failed caulk line at the countertop lets moisture wick behind the tile, the mastic lets go, and tiles start sounding hollow. We fix the cause, not just the symptom, sealing the joint properly when we're done. Backsplash Repair Cost in Silver Spring & Rockville, MD
Cost depends on how many tiles, whether we have matching stock, and the condition of the wall behind. All prices include labor:
| Service | Typical Cost Range |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Replace 1–3 cracked tiles | $150 – $350 | Match, set & grout |
| Re-set loose / hollow tiles | $180 – $450 | Fix the underlying cause |
| Re-grout a backsplash section | $150 – $400 | Rake out & refresh joints |
| Re-caulk counter-to-wall seam | $90 – $200 | Waterproof the joint |
| Wall repair behind failed tile | +$120 – $350 | Drywall / backer as needed |

Real Local Insight from the DMV
The most common backsplash failure we see across Rockville and Silver Spring kitchens starts at the countertop caulk line: it's the first joint to fail, and once it does, DMV humidity plus daily sink splashing drives water behind the bottom row of tile. Six months later those tiles are drumming hollow. Catching it at the caulk stage is a $150 fix; letting it run until the mastic fails and the wall softens turns it into a multi-hundred-dollar tile-and-drywall job. We always check that seam first.
Matching tile is the other local challenge, because so many DMV kitchens were tiled 15 to 25 years ago with a specific ceramic or glass line that's since been discontinued. We keep a good eye for close matches, and when there's no exact stock we'll pull a tile from a hidden spot โ behind the range, under an upper cabinet โ to patch the visible damage and put the odd tile where nobody looks. It's an old tile-setter's trick that makes a repair in a Bethesda or Potomac kitchen genuinely invisible.
